Realme GT 7T India launch will take place next week, and only a few days remain until it is available in India and global markets. Teasers from the Shenzhen-based smartphone maker confirm the upcoming handset will feature a MediaTek Dimensity 8400 Max chip. It's also confirmed to arrive with a 7,000mAh battery that can be charged at 120W. from Gadgets 360 https://ift.tt/LMtiY7d
